Transaction 284e95a17aca9dd8512d9952991cffda7ca3470259dd18b7eebce3f3585725a3

1 Input
2 Outputs
  • 284e95a17aca9dd8512d9952991cffda7ca3470259dd18b7eebce3f3585725a3:0
  • value  374244594
    address  bc1qsgtp95h0f4d3jawywqef6z7ny02dxps924x3y2
  • 284e95a17aca9dd8512d9952991cffda7ca3470259dd18b7eebce3f3585725a3:1
  • value  3033700
    address  3FhizLApxJ6Mf8aFUHf1aaMhGQ3G6H5Cec